lawdog77

Quote from: tower912 on January 06, 2022, 08:00:17 AM
Markus Howard will be MU's leading scorer when we are all in the ground.     Top 25 all time.    And probably would have been top 20 without COVID.   I appreciate him for what he did accomplish.   
Definitely would have been Top 20. He is #21, only 8 points behind JJ Redick for #20. I think he would have scored that in the 2 games remaining.


brewcity77

Quote from: lawdog77 on January 06, 2022, 09:41:29 AM
Definitely would have been Top 20. He is #21, only 8 points behind JJ Redick for #20. I think he would have scored that in the 2 games remaining.

Had he stayed healthy and played two more, he probably would've made it to #18 (finished 43 behind Kevin Birdsong, averaged 27.8 ppg). If we win a couple games, the top-15 was within reach (Hansbrough was 111 points ahead, his average over 4 games would've equaled that).

That said, the "couple games" would've been a matchup with Seton Hall in the BET and most likely either an 8/9 game or 7/10 in the NCAA Tournament, followed by a 1 or 2 seed (94 of 97 brackets on BracketMatrix 2020 had MU between the 7-10 lines). Not sure Wojo would've guided them to any more Ws.
